PSC to take Dayasiri to court

30 Jun 2019

By Sarah Hannan The Presidential Select Committee (PSC) on the Easter Sunday attacks warned it will take former Minister Dayasiri Jayasekara to court if he fails to appear before the committee despite being issued two summons. The PSC will have its next hearing on 10 July, The Sunday Morning learnt. Jayasekara was summoned before the PSC last week but failed to appear and told Parliament he will not do so. Deputy Speaker of Parliament and Chair of the PSC Ananda Kumarasiri told The Sunday Morning that if the MP fails to appear, legal action will be taken against him. “We are giving the former Minister another chance on 10 July to appear at the PSC hearings. If he decides not to show up, we will take legal action against him.” The hearings have now arrived at a point where some scheduled hearings had been postponed. While the Prime Minister is speculated to appear at the PSC hearings to record his statement, Kumarasiri said that the PSC members are still discussing the possibility and necessity of summoning the Premier. “When we commenced these hearings, we estimated to conclude them by the end of July. However, with the present situation, we are unable to announce a fixed day to conclude these hearings,” Kumarasiri noted. Elaborating further, the Deputy Speaker noted that after each statement was recorded, there were instances that additional individuals who were not on the scheduled list of respondents would need to be summoned. Following that, the PSC will also have to get these individuals to appear before the PSC to record statements, to support the investigations. Meanwhile, The Sunday Morning contacted MP Jayasekara to inquire from him the probability of him appearing at the next hearing. Jayasekara revealed that he was yet to obtain some clarifications from the Speaker of the Parliament pertaining to the standing orders passed by the Parliament. “There are several clarifications over the topics that are discussed at the PSC hearings and there are subjugates. There are five cases against the head of the state and the relevant authorities. The Attorney General Dappula Livera, in a letter to the President, stated that there are concerns over the issues raised by the committee over the case that is progressing in the Supreme Court.” Jayasekara stated that the Speaker of Parliament needed to give a ruling and table the letter that the President’s Secretary had sent. He further stated that once the proceedings commenced in the Parliament, some of the issues itemised on these letters needed to be submitted to the Parliament. “The Speaker of the Parliament should give us a ruling saying that these are not sub judice. Minister Laskhman Kiriella on Friday raised an issue on the PSC hearings, stating that the Parliament was not abiding by judicial style proceedings. We, as the Parliament, have passed standing orders within the parliamentary rules, and if we are to violate the rules of the Parliament, I fail to understand how these proceedings need to be conducted,” Jayasekara noted, adding that once the Speaker provided him with sufficient clarifications in the upcoming days, he would consider appearing before the PSC.
